Apply for this vacancy

  Upload Your CV
Apply via LinkedIn
or call Mieke Van Tonder on:
0191 620 0123
Interested in referring a friend? Click here
Location: UK Remote Tyne and Wear Newcastle upon Tyne NE12 8BX
Salary: £75000 - £100000
Sector: PHP  
Type: Permanent
Posted: 11/24/2025
Senior Magento Developer Ronald James Group 2026-02-24

We’re looking for an experienced Senior Magento Developer with strong React.js skills to join a growing, forward-thinking development team within the healthcare industry. The organisation builds modern, secure, and user-focused e-commerce platforms, delivering high-quality digital solutions that support a wide range of users and business needs.

Key Responsibilities:

Magento Development

  • Design, develop, and maintain high-performance Magento 2 e-commerce solutions

  • Create custom modules, themes, and extensions

  • Optimise Magento installations for performance, scalability, and security

  • Integrate third-party APIs and payment gateways

  • Implement advanced e-commerce features including multi-store setups, custom checkout flows, and inventory management

  • Ensure compliance with Magento best practices and coding standards

Frontend Development

  • Develop modern, responsive user interfaces using React.js

  • Build reusable React components for consistent user experiences

  • Integrate React applications with Magento backend APIs

  • Implement state management solutions

  • Optimise frontend performance and ensure cross-browser compatibility

Technical Leadership

  • Mentor junior developers and provide technical guidance

  • Conduct code reviews and maintain coding standards
    Collaborate with UX/UI designers to deliver pixel-perfect implementations

  • Participate in architectural decisions and technical planning
    Stay current with developments in Magento and React.js

  • Leverage AI tools to enhance productivity and code quality

Project Management

  • Collaborate with project managers and stakeholders to deliver projects on time

  • Provide accurate estimates for development tasks

  • Document technical solutions and maintain project documentation
    Participate in agile development practices

Essential Requirements:

  • 5+ years of Magento development experience (Magento 2 preferred)

  • 3+ years of React.js development experience

  • Strong PHP (OOP) programming skills
    Proficiency in JavaScript, HTML5, CSS3, SASS/LESS

  • Experience with MySQL database design and optimisation

  • Knowledge of RESTful APIs and GraphQL

  • Familiarity with version control systems

  • Strong understanding of responsive design

  • Experience with build tools

  • AWS cloud services experience with deployment pipelines

  • Vercel deployment and hosting experience

  • Understanding of pharmaceutical industry compliance (desirable)

  • Deep understanding of Magento architecture and MVC patterns
    Experience with Magento CLI, deployment processes, and caching strategies
    Knowledge of Magento admin customisation

  • Understanding of Magento security best practices
    Experience with Magento performance optimisation techniques

  • Strong understanding of React.js fundamentals and hooks

  • Experience with state management libraries (Redux, MobX, Context API)

  • Knowledge of React testing frameworks (Jest, React Testing Library)

  • Familiarity with Next.js or similar frameworks

  • Understanding of modern JavaScript (ES6+) and TypeScript

Desirable Requirements

  • Magento certification

  • Experience with headless e-commerce architectures
    Experience with AI development tools (Copilot, ChatGPT, Claude, etc.)

  • Experience with cloud platforms (AWS preferred)

  • Experience with Docker/Kubernetes
    Understanding of CI/CD pipelines

  • Healthcare/pharmaceutical industry experience

  • Knowledge of other e-commerce platforms

  • Experience with mobile app development (React Native)

  • Understanding of regulatory requirements (GDPR, HIPAA, MHRA) 

Apply today!

Apply Now Chat on WhatsApp Chat on Messenger

 

Back to Jobs

</Follow Us>